AutoPPP and usernames

I'm using mgetty with AutoPPP and pap aut successfully at the
moment with the following line in login.config:
/AutoPPP/ - a_ppp /usr/sbin/pppd auth -chap +pap modem crtscts lock proxyarp -detach
I want to log the username in wtmp/utmp thats using authppp pap auth, is
it possible to do this? So that when i type who, fingers, w, etc i get
the username that is dialed in. It works fine if the client uses a login
script as they use /etc/passwd directly and there shell is /usr/sbin/pppd,
but they must be a way to do it with the autoppp!
